Our College

Mernda Central College has been constructed under the Public Private Partnership (PPP) Project. Under the PPP model, the college has been financed, designed, constructed and maintained by the private sector to high contractual standards over 25 years, allowing Principals and teachers to focus on student learning, rather than asset management.

The College, located on Breadalbane Avenue, Mernda in the City of Whittlesea, commenced operation in January 2017. Initial programs catered for students in Years Foundation to 7. The College will continue to grow to Year 12 in 2022.

The state of the art facility provides the very best in contemporary educational design and promotes active student-centred learning through the creation of adaptable, functional spaces.

Our College provides access to an education that is seamless from Prep right through to Year 12 and is divided in to three schools:

  • Junior School for Prep to Year 4 students

  • Middle School for Year 5 to Year 8 students

  • Senior School for Year 9 to Year 12 students.
